Bohemian Style is the one that is known as boho, and this dressing style was highly popular in the 60s and 70s. The essence of ‘boho’ is flowy and free fabrics. This fashion was a bit behind and is now making its place in the fashion forefront. Tips to master the bohemian style:

Tip 1: Look unconcerned about what you wore

This may sound strange, but that is bohemian style. Get neutral colors clothing; accessories are a must, anything a pair of sunglasses, old bracelet or some bandana. Maintain a carefree attitude.

Tip 2: Get right pair of boots

A true bohemian always has some leather boots. The authentic look is with older boots that are worn out or appear really old. Wear without tying shoelaces or even torn boots, and you officially look like a desert hippie, a bohemian.

Tip 3: Wear torn jeans

Overlook your parent’s comments, for bohemian styles find your old jeans from behind your wardrobe. Use scissors and give some horrible cuts. Bohemians are aware of the fact that legs must get enough air to breathe. Wearing this you will feel fresh even in hot summers.

Tip 4: Baggy shirt

Get a baggy shirt. Remember it should expose more of your chest hair. The bohemians wore a baggy shirt giving an impression of full comfort and liberty of movement. In this way, it also provides a feel of you are a relaxed dude. Go crazy, do not restrict for the classic tones, and instead get cool designs and colors.

Tip 5: Let loose your mane

Hair in bohemian style has a significant role, and so the bohemian style may sound unfair to bald men. If you wish to appear stylish, take care of your beard and hair, grow it carefully and visit the barber regularly. This will keep your mane balanced.

Tip 6: Consider art into attire

You may have a bohemian style with inscriptions, hand painted details, graphics and also messages. Add some matching accessories and fully printed jacket as well. Of course, do not miss a simply printed scarf.

Tip7: Go all floral

It is time to forget your striped shirts and opt for something floral. You will feel free-spirited. Try a print version on your chinos and ensure an off-duty look. Keep it mellow with styling, no collar stiffeners, and no cufflinks and enjoy the perfect bohemian look.
